Depends on your circumstances
If you're a millionaire, then Kenny Hills (Bukit Tuanku) or Damansara Heights (Bukit Damansara) would be the area,or perhaps the area around Jalan U Thant in Ampang.
If you're pretty well off, but not yet a millionaire, then Bangsar or Mont Kiara might be your choice.
If you're just "comfortable", then perhaps Taman Tun Dr.Ismail or Sri Hartamas might suit.

It depends on your choice of accomodations.

For bungalows (detached homes) the most prestigious areas are Taman Duta and Kenny Hills (a.k.a Bukit Tunku) with Damansara Heights a half step behind . These areas are super expensive and many properties have sprawling lawns. The homes here are generally older (>30 yrs) but superbly maintained. These areas are full of greenery and density is low although some condos are starting to creep in.
If you prefer living within a golf resort then look at Tropicana (Petaling Jaya) and Country heights. Newer (<15 years) and more modern styled homes and also low density. Some have their own pools and there are loads of recreation facilities in the clubhouses nearby.

For condominiums the popular location for expats is now Seri Hartamas where there are lots of happening pubs and eateries and also an International school. There are also some well appointed condominiums in the centre of the City, near KLCC.
